63014 vs 63068 — Compare ZIP Codes

Side-by-side comparison. Blue = ZIP 63014, Orange = ZIP 63068.

Quick verdict: ZIP 63014 is more affordable rent, lower unemployment, more educated. ZIP 63068 is wealthier, higher home values, lower poverty rate, more diverse, higher work-from-home share.
